DIY Water Softener Installation: A Step-by-Step Guide

Hard water can aggravate your skin, dull your clothes, and leave unsightly marks on your fixtures. Fortunately, installing a DIY water softener is a simple project that can alleviate these problems. This step-by-step guide will walk you through the process, equipping you with the knowledge to purify your water and enjoy its many benefits.

  • Before you begin, evaluate your water hardness level using a home test kit. This will help you pick the right size softener for your needs.
  • Identify a suitable location near your main water line. Ensure it's accessible for maintenance and has adequate space for the unit.
  • Carefully follow the manufacturer's guidelines provided with your DIY water softener kit.
  • Connect the bypass valve, brine tank, and control valve to the main water line. Ensure all connections are secure and leak-proof.
  • Fill the brine tank with the recommended salt solution according to the manufacturer's instructions.
  • Program the softener's settings based on your water usage and hardness level.
  • Test the softened water by running it through faucets and appliances to confirm its effectiveness.

With a little effort, you can successfully install a DIY water softener and experience the rewards of soft, clean water.

Choosing the Right Water Softener System for Your Home

Deciding on a water softener can feel overwhelming with all the options available. A properly configured system is essential for effectively softening your water and ensuring it meets your household's needs. Start by assessing your water hardness level using a test kit from your local hardware store. This information will help you identify the right flow rate for your softener. Consider the volume of water your household uses daily, as well as the quantity of people living in your home. A good rule of thumb is to opt for a system that can handle at least one and a half times your average daily water usage.

  • Research different types of softeners, such as salt-based, salt-free, and potassium chloride systems, to find the best option for your situation.
  • Contrast features like regeneration cycle length, effectiveness, and installation complexity before making a buy.
  • Don't dismiss to read online ratings from other homeowners to obtain valuable knowledge about different brands and models.

Remember that a properly installed and upkept water softener can substantially improve the standard of your water, making it gentler on your skin, hair, and appliances.
